visual range

 

Definitions from WordNet

Noun visual range has 1 sense
  1. visual range - distance at which a given standard object can be seen with the unaided eye
    --1 is a kind of
    visibility, visibleness

Visual Range

Definition:

Visual range refers to the maximum distance at which an object or a person can be seen clearly with the naked eye.

Senses:

Sense 1 - Noun:

The maximum distance at which an object or a person can be seen clearly with the naked eye.

Example Sentences:
  1. The lighthouse's light can be seen within a visual range of 20 miles.
  2. In foggy conditions, the visual range is significantly reduced.
